CHAPTER 36

SHOULDER

Mercifully, the traffic had eased, and they were finally able to open up the full power of the Audi engine as they reached the end of the A3 and merged onto the A3(M). The call with the woman named Pemberton had been a success, but he’d found it difficult to relax in the back seat. Time was running out, and they were still over twenty miles out from Portsmouth. And that was twenty miles of potential error and mistake. Nothing could go wrong. And that allowed the paranoia in his mind to wander and fester like an infection in an open wound.

They were driving in the fast lane, Luke cradling the speedometer a few miles per hour over seventy. Discretion and remaining as under the radar as possible was paramount. So far, Luke had impressed Danny. The youngest brother had shown his ability in keeping to the stringent restrictions of the Highway Code. But it was bittersweet, because it meant that Freddy had taught him something worthwhile.

In a world where they didn’t have a dad, Freddy was the closest thing to a figure that Luke could look up to. There were times when Luke and Freddy would venture to the shops together, chill together in the living room, play video games and smoke cigarettes while Danny worked tirelessly in a supermarket to put food on the table. It was unfair, and a piece of Danny had died every time he’d realised how close they were – every time he’d come home and found Freddy poorly helping Luke with some of his homework or teaching him how to roll his own joints. It was more than just a slap in the face; it was a punch in the stomach, a kick in the balls and a knife in the back. But without Freddy, The Crimsons wouldn’t have existed, which was something he was painfully aware of.

‘Uh-oh,’ Luke said, his eyes jumping up and down in the rearview mirror.

‘What is it?’ Danny didn’t like the sound of that. Not good. Not good. He tilted forward and clung to Luke’s headrest. At first he thought it was an engine issue, a puncture, or maybe they’d bizarrely run out of petrol. But then, when the sirens sounded behind him, everything seemed to slow down. Feeling like he was moving in slow motion, Danny twisted in his seat and peered out of the back window.

Over a hundred yards behind them, gaining rapidly in the right-hand line, blue and white lights flashing vehemently, was a police car.

‘Shit!’ Danny spun round and shifted himself into the middle of the back seat. Luke’s eyes were moving left and right furiously, his chest heaving and his knuckles as pale as the rest of him. ‘Just keep it steady, all right. Don’t do anything stupid. Pull into the middle lane and let them pass. We don’t know whether they’re looking for us or whether it’s—’

Luke swerved the Audi into the middle lane of traffic with a movement so drastic Danny was propelled into the door and smashed his head against the window.
